Summary/Abstract: After having already informed the German public opinion in Vormärz about some aspects of the situation in Transylvania and of the Transylvanian Romanians status, Allgemeine Zeitung published in 1848-1849, several articles and correspondences that comprised relations and news about them. Without embracing the Romanians' aspirations and forms of struggle, the correspondents reflected the emergence of the national movement and informed the public opinion about the liberal-democratic program of the Romanian revolution comprised in the Petition-Resolution from Blaj. Afterwards, through the intermediary of the paper, there was also expressed the outlook of the Romanian leading circles concerning the armed rising against the oppression for the protection of the national being and the right to self determination, the readers also learning about their huge sacrifices in order to fulfil this desideratum. Through the intermediary of the famous German daily newspaper, Europe learned about the existence of a “Romanian question” in Transylvania, demanding its solution in a democratic spirit.
